Subject: Key rotation — GarageSense occupancy feed

Rotating the GarageSense feed key tonight, 22:00. Affects the occupancy ingest for the Northgate and Pierpoint structures only; display boards are unaffected. Old key dies at 22:15 — anything still using it will 401 and the dashboard will show stale counts. Release manager action: bump the secret in the deploy config before the 21:30 freeze and confirm the canary reads non-zero occupancy after cutover. No other changes ride along. New key follows.

app token of bahaf-tajeg = zpat23_SjjsllwiLmXbtS65veZaV47

# Session Handling — Vexbird Autocomplete

Autocomplete index rebuilds are slow (~40 min) because session-scoped caches invalidate on every deploy. Workaround: pin sessions to the warm index node until the Tindall shard split lands. Release manager: hold canary promotion if p95 lookup exceeds 300ms.

To trigger a manual warm-up against staging, call the reindex endpoint using the bearer token below.

bearer token for bawif-yafog: eyJhbGciOiJIUzI1NiIsInR5cCI6IkpXVCJ9.eyJzdWIiOiI6jnqjvIn0.QKekXKaz

**Ticket: LINGO-442 — string extraction script failing**

Heads up for the sync: the nightly translation-string extraction job for Phrasecart has been red since Tuesday. Turns out the service token for Lexiport expired and nobody got the alert. Quick fix, no code changes needed. Here's the fresh key for the extractor config.

service key, fawip-bajef: kto11_Qt5wZK9vdNC

INTERNAL MEMO — Joint Venture Proposal

To: Sales Leads

Vornell Dynamics has proposed a joint venture covering distribution in the Calderis region. Terms under review; due diligence runs four weeks. Do not discuss with customers or partners. Continue current pipeline work as normal. Pricing and territory questions go through me only. A decision is expected by quarter-end. Rationale and positioning are covered in the confidential note below.

management briefing: Silethax Systems plans to raise the Holix list price by 50.2 percent in December. The steering committee signed off on a budget of $329.9 million for Project Holok. The renewal with Juldorax Foods closes at $278.2 million a year, 54.3 percent above the last contract. Project Briir slips by one quarter because of the supplier delay.